Julia: append to an empty vector

Solution 1

Your variable x does not contain an array but a type.

x = Vector{Float64}
typeof(x)  # DataType

You can create an array as Array(Float64, n) (but beware, it is uninitialized: it contains arbitrary values) or zeros(Float64, n), where n is the desired size.

Since Float64 is the default, we can leave it out. Your example becomes:

x = zeros(0)
append!( x, rand(10) )

Solution 2

I am somewhat new to Julia and came across this question after getting a similar error. To answer the original question for Julia version 1.2.0, all that is missing are ():

x = Vector{Float64}()
append!(x, rand(10))

This solution (unlike x=zeros(0)) works for other data types, too. For example, to create an empty vector to store dictionaries use:

d = Vector{Dict}()
push!(d, Dict("a"=>1, "b"=>2))

A note regarding use of push! and append!:

According to the Julia help, push! is used to add individual items to a collection, while append! adds an collection of items to a collection. So, the following pieces of code create the same array:

Push individual items:

a = Vector{Float64}()
push!(a, 1.0)
push!(a, 2.0)

Append items contained in an array:

a = Vector{Float64}()
append!(a, [1.0, 2.0])

Solution 3

You can initialize an empty Vector of any type by typing the type in front of []. Like:

Float64[] # Returns what you want
Array{Float64, 2}[] # Vector of Array{Float64,2}
Any[] # Can contain anything
